The Mennonite Central Committee brings relief, development and peace efforts in the name of Christ, sponsored by Anabaptists around the world.  This month, MCC celebrates its centennial, and we will be focusing on MCC, culminating in a special offering on October 18.  You can give at any time to MCC directly, or by noting “MCC” on the memo line of your church offering check.
